COLUMBIA – The South Carolina Department of Public Safety announces the following FOURTH OF JULY MEDIA/PUBLIC events. The public is invited to meet the Highway Patrol at the following locations/talk with them about July 4 activities in their area. Members of the SCDPS Families of Highway Fatalities group will join the Highway Patrol in most locations to assist.
